Four South American nations sign strategic minerals pact

SANTIAGO, Aug 28 (Reuters) – Chile, Argentina, Bolivia and Peru signed a joint declaration on Friday to deepen cooperation on strategic minerals, aiming to boost development, coordination and investment as the four South American producers seek to position the region as a reliable global supplier for the energy transition.

The nations, which hold significant copper and lithium reserves, said in a statement they would seek technical and financial backing from multilateral institutions and launch joint public-private calls for research, innovation and institution-building projects.
